UNC 0642 is a selective and potent G9a and GLP inhibitor. It exhibits >2,000-fold selectivity for G9a and GLP over PRC2-EZH2 and >20,000-fold selectivity over other methyltransferases. UNC 0642 reduces H3K9 dimethylation levels in MDA-MB-231 cells (IC50=110 nM). Histone methylation, specifically the methylation of lysine residues on histones, plays a role in determining the structure of euchromatin and regulating gene expression. Two important histone methyltransferases, G9a and G9a-like protein (GLP), are responsible for mono- or dimethylating lysine 9 on histone 3. This methylation process contributes significantly to early embryogenesis, genomic imprinting, and lymphocyte development.
